Heavy afternoon showers drenched parts of the island yesterday, causing flooding in some areas.
Many people were seen in their rain gear as they travelled to their various destinations. Police reported a number of accidents and appealed to drivers to exercise more caution on the roads because of the heavy rainfall.
A number of planned events were are also cancelled.
Here, a flooded Trents Tenantry, St James, yesterday, with water surrounding some homes. (RL)
